Mine showed up yesterday. Workmanship is way better than my Hookers, but it looks like they aren't as close to equal-length as the Hookers. My other concern is that they will partially shroud the top of my heavily ported exhaust ports (I have to open up the top of FelPro 1406 gaskets to fit the port opening). I wish Jet-Hot would have raised the tube holes in the flanges about 0.200". I'm going to fire up the die grinder to make the opening taller, but there isn't much meat there.

Gasket-wise, I've never used the gaskets that came with headers. In my experience. they have invariably been cheap paper gaskets that would blow out in a day or so.
